Information on Dipotassium EDTA
Dipotassium EDTA is a derivative of Ethylenediamine Tetraacetic Acid (EDTA). EDTA is a synthetic amino acid and a sequestering/chelating agent. The acid form is a white powder that is insoluble in water. It is used to dissolve metallic impurities. EDTA grabs metallic cations like lead or calcium and forms a stable compound that is then excreted from the system.
Synthesis / Manufacturing Process of Dipotassium EDTA
The compound was first prepared in 1935 by Ferdinand Munz from Ethylenediamine (EDA) and Monochloroacetic acid.
Specifications:
CAS NO: 2001-94-7 (Anhydrous); 25102-12-9 (Dihydrate).
HSN No.: 29173990.
Synonyms: Ethylenediaminetetraacetic Acid Dipotassium, N,N’-1,2-ethanediylbis(N-(carboxymethyl)glycine) edetic acid Dipotassium Salt.
Molecular Formula: C₁₀H₁₄N₂O₈K₂·2H₂O.
Molecular Weight: 404.47.
Appearance: White Fine Crystalline Powder.
Solubility: Soluble In Water, Clear Solution.
Assay: 99.0% Min..
pH: 4.0-6.5.
